"Pop will save us."
Behind Van Orton Design are two twin brothers from Turin, Italy. Together, they are shaking up the art scene with works that look like garishly colourful pop culture icons in the style of leaded stained glass church windows. It all started when the brothers reinterpreted cult films from the 80s with their work. The sequel: clients such as ESPN, Warner Brothers and the Rolling Stones. Van Orton recently showed their work at the Netflix & Dreamworks Voltron Exhibition in Los Angeles.
